Transaction 124e9ce8ace03d20ff49b5c5d363d628fb8c8ca282dacb98be15a853baaba27e

6 Input
1 Outputs
  • 124e9ce8ace03d20ff49b5c5d363d628fb8c8ca282dacb98be15a853baaba27e:0
  • value  621835
    address  bc1qu40kd83jx0j424n904nje3sch24flq6cwzv73t